MARKETS BY WIRE.

(Furnished by The Farmers Grain Market, H. H. Potter, Mgr.) Live Stock Market. Hogs—Receipts, 30,000; higher, 15c. to 25c; top, $14.85. Cattle—Receipts, 11,000. Sheep—Receipts, 7,000. Indianapolis Hogs—Receipts, 6,000; top, $15.00. Grain Market. May oats opened at .79 3-4 and .80; closed at .80 5-8 and 3-4. July oats opened at .72 3-8; closed at .73 and, .73 1-8. May corn opened at 1.32 1-4 and 1.32; closed at 1.34 and 1.33 7-8. July corn opened at 1.29 1-8 and 1.29; closed at 1.30 7-8 and 1.30 3-4. Sept corn opened at 126 1/4; closed at 1.28 1-8.
